Description: This is my 65 tall aga. Reef tank... I have a 20 gal. DIY mud filter with a berline Protein Skimmer,for flow I have a squid on my return and i have one hydor koralia-4 and one hydor koralia-1, My lighting is 2 - 250w. MH and my bulbs i have now are SPS blue life 14000k.. Then i have 2 - 96w PC. Actinic's.. And a 20 led moon light...
Advice: Don't give up !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
Fish Kept: 1-clown tang,1-Sailfin Blenny, 1- pink spotted goby, 3-Green Chromis, 1-coral Beauty angelfish, 2- False percula clown's , And alot of blue leg hermit's and snail's
Corals/Plants: 3- Bubble tip anemone's , Frogspawn coral , one small Acropora Frag. , Assorted zoanthid's , 1-Colt coral , Green Star polyp's , Trumpet coral , 1- small montipora frag. , Cup coral (turbinaria Crater) green , one pink and purple plate coral Short tentacle , green mushrooms. bubble coral, green hydnaphora sp. And about 50 lbs. live rock
Tank Size: 65 gallons
